Tempter 0 Denunciar post Postado Julho 28, 2005 Pessoal eu to com o seguinte problema. Tenho uma seção de meu site que contem uma include, esta include busca um conteúdo dinâmico, usando o WAMP5 a seção puxa a include sem problemas, agora usando o PHP TRIAD não funciona. Eis o que acontece: A seção tem a seguinte include: PHP [*]<? include [*]("http://localhost/wt/wt/site/_secoes/secoes?subaction=showfull&id=1122300787&archive=&start_from=&ucat=&"); [*] ?> No WAMP5 (Funciona) trazendo o conteúdo: PHP [*]OLÁ PESSOAL DO FÓRUM IMASTERS No PHP TRIAD retorna o seguinte erro, o que pode ser ? PHP [*]Warning: Failed opening [*]'http://localhost/wt/site/_secoes/secoes? [*]subaction=showfull&id=1122300787 [*]&archive=&start_from=&ucat=&' [*] for inclusion (include_path='.;c:\apache\php\pear') [*]in c:\apache\htdocs\wt\site\lista_de_shows\lista_de_shows.php [*] on line 16 Sei que é a versão do PHP influenciando, as configurações no PHP.ini mas é que eu não entendo quase nada de PHP, tenho até medo que as coisas que eu estou fazendo em meu site em PHP não funcionem a hora que eu mandar para o meu servidor, pois em um funciona, e em outro naum :/ Alguem pode me ajudar ? Obrigado pessoal Compartilhar este post Link para o post Compartilhar em outros sites
Tempter 0 Denunciar post Postado Julho 28, 2005 Desculpem eu ter deixado o post mei desconfigurado :$ Compartilhar este post Link para o post Compartilhar em outros sites
Thompson 0 Denunciar post Postado Julho 28, 2005 bom, configurar isso eh relativamente facil. o problema nao eh no php.ini,mas sim no htdocs do apache. veja a pasta.... c:\apache\htdocs\wt\site\lista_de_shows\lista_de_shows.php a pasta wt existe dentro da pasta htdocs do apache?? se nao existir, vctemq colocar ela la. essa pasta eh a raiz do apache, ela q eh o seu localhost. você pode mudar essa pasta alterando o DOCUMENT ROOT do apache.... la dentro do htdocs. ajudei em algo? se nao, posta de novo ae :D eu nao manjo de phptriad e derivados... eu curtoconfigurar meu php na unha e fazer tudo na unha heheh assim qdo surge problema eu ja sei onde eh http://forum.imasters.com.br/public/style_emoticons/default/joia.gif Compartilhar este post Link para o post Compartilhar em outros sites
Tempter 0 Denunciar post Postado Julho 28, 2005 Fala cara...então a pasta existe sim, está tudo funcionando perfeitamente.O problem é que no WAMP 5 o include é aberta, normalmente, mas com o memso caminho e pasta no PHP TRIAD não funciona...o que seria ? Compartilhar este post Link para o post Compartilhar em outros sites
Tempter 0 Denunciar post Postado Julho 28, 2005 Será que se eu colocar onlie (não tenho como fazer isso agora) vai funcionar como no WAMP5 ou vai dar erro como no PHP TRIAD ? tem como saber quando um código em PHP não funciona mais nas novas versões ?Eu ainda não consegui resolver, se alguem puder ajudar. Compartilhar este post Link para o post Compartilhar em outros sites
Tempter 0 Denunciar post Postado Julho 28, 2005 Alguem sabe pq no Easy PHP tb funciona ? aonde eu altero a configuração para isso funcionar tb no PHP TRIAD ? Compartilhar este post Link para o post Compartilhar em outros sites
Tempter 0 Denunciar post Postado Julho 29, 2005 Olá Adailton Antes de tudo, obrigado pela ajuda. Então, olha só o que eu fiz: Funciona no WAMP5 mas não no PHP Triad PHP [*]<? include [*]("http://localhost/wt/wt/site/_secoes/secoes?subaction=showfull&id=1122300787&archive=&start_from=&ucat=&"); [*] ?> Não funciona em nenhum dos dois PHP [*]<? include [*]("c:/wamp/www/wt/site/_secoes/secoes?subaction=showfull&id=1122300787&archive=&start_from=&ucat=&"); [*]?> Não funciona em nenhum dos dois PHP [*]<? include [*]("../_secoes/secoes?subaction=showfull&id=1122300787&archive=&start_from=&ucat=&"); [*]?> E mais uma pergunta. Se não funciona com o endereço URL, só com o direto do documento, como eu posso fazer isso quando estiver onlie, não tem forma de fazer com o HTTP://WWW... no início do endereço ? Só uma dúvida, percebi que tem coisas que funcionam no WAMP5 e não no PHP Tria, isso é a segunda vez que me acontece, você sabe me dizer se corro o risco de o que estou fazendo não venha a funcionar quando eu colocar ONLINE ? T+ Brigadão Cleber Compartilhar este post Link para o post Compartilhar em outros sites
red neck * 0 Denunciar post Postado Julho 29, 2005 pois é, eu errei =[pode sim fazer include por http....mais leia a nota do sr php.net A versões Windows do PHP anteriores ao PHP 4.3.0 não suportam acesso a arquivos remotos através desta função, mesmo se allow_url_fopen estiver ativado.[]'s Compartilhar este post Link para o post Compartilhar em outros sites
Nebert 0 Denunciar post Postado Março 21, 2007 cara de boa mesmo...tive este problema e resolvi da seguinte forma <?php include("conteudo.php"); ?>ou seja não usei so a tag de abertura <? e sim <?php para abrir Compartilhar este post Link para o post Compartilhar em outros sites
Skyo 1 Denunciar post Postado Abril 9, 2007 Bom para resolver isso vá no simbolo do WAMP5 > Opções do PHP > habilite short open tag e atualize.Edit: uhehuehue mal por responder esse tópico, quase 3 semanas atrás sei la eu, é que eu fui parar na página dele. Compartilhar este post Link para o post Compartilhar em outros sites
crzmn 0 Denunciar post Postado Maio 1, 2007 ctz q ninguém vai ler mais isso, post pouco antigo.. mas tive o mesmo problema e...php5...; Whether to allow include/require to open URLs (like http:// or ftp://) as files.allow_url_include = OnNo wamp vem Off.. coloque on e seja feeelizzz! Compartilhar este post Link para o post Compartilhar em outros sites